Job Posting #: 922667
Position: Research Associate I (Patient Research Liaison)
Salary : $34.12 to $42.65 per hour commensurate with experience and consistent with UHN compensation policy
The University Health Network, where “above all else the needs of patients come first”, encompasses Toronto General Hospital, Toronto Western Hospital, Princess Margaret Cancer Centre, Toronto Rehabilitation Institute and the Michener Institute of Education. The breadth of research, the complexity of the cases treated, and the magnitude of its educational enterprise has made UHN a national and international resource for patient care, research and education. With a long tradition of ground breaking firsts and a purpose of “Transforming lives and communities through excellence in care, discovery and learning”, the University Health Network (UHN), Canada’s largest research teaching hospital, brings together over 16,000 employees, more than 1,200 physicians, 8,000+ students, and many volunteers. UHN is a caring, creative place where amazing people are amazing the world.
The Patient Research Liaison (Research Associate I) will be responsible for safely building and fostering a positive research presence on designated clinical inpatient units; acting as liaison between research and clinical staff, around patient recruitment as well as research processes on the clinical units; conduct pre-screening, screening and consent procedures for research studies using the Centralized Recruitment process; acting as ongoing liaison between patients and research, monitoring their continued consent and understanding of the research process; responding effectively and appropriately to patients’ ongoing level of comfort in regard to their participation in research; tailoring the discussion and consent process to the patient’s impairments, communication, and cognitive abilities; acquiring detailed knowledge and understanding of privacy and confidentiality as it relates to research implementation; maintaining accurate and detailed hard and soft copy documentation of recruitment records; aggregating recruitment data into regular and ad-hoc customized reports for researchers, clinicians, and corporate leadership; assisting with preparation of talks, articles, reports, and other ad-hoc tasks related to Centralized Recruitment; attending relevant clinical team, research or lab meetings, working as part of inter-professional treatment and research teams; and operating with infallible standards of privacy, ethics, and integrity.
A Master’s Degree in sciences with 2 years related experience and/or a Bachelors’ degree with 5 years experience in a clinic research setting.
Strong verbal and interpersonal communication skills prior experience working and/or communicating with vulnerable patient populations and/or in a rehabilitation centre considered an asset.
Demonstrated in-depth knowledge of research methods and procedures, specifically the informed consent process
Strong understanding of research ethics and privacy law.
Affinity for networking and building personal relationships.
Sound moral judgement.
Demonstrated 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ks and timelines.
Understand the value of adhering to standard operating procedures and routine practices.
Proficient with Microsoft Office: Excel data organization, data types, filtering sorting and aggregating records, Word & Powerpoint.
